Systematic relations between collective energies from the GCM and RPA methods

Description

It has previously been found numerically that GCM and RPA methods using the same forces can give almost the same collective energies. It is pointed out that there are systematic reasons for this. When the GCM approach is used with the usual Gaussian Overlap Approximation, the energy has a lower limit in terms of RPA energies. If oscillator properties are assigned to the orbitals, the inequalities are converted into equalities. It is shown that some formulations of the GCM approach imply violation of sum-rules, so should be used with caution. (Auth.)
